Alberta-based company has been selected to include their product, an orb-shaped nail file, in the gift bags for the Stars at the 2010 Golden Globe Awards in January. Melody Murphy, President and CEO of Jagorb International initially thought it was a hoax when she received an email from Rita Branch of Secret Room Events asking if she would like to be a gift bag sponsor.

Upon further research, Murphy discovered that Secret Room Events is responsible for the gift suites at the Golden Globe, Emmy and MTV Awards. “This was a huge surprise since our company is less than a year old,” says Murphy. “Secret Room Events is always on the lookout for new and unique products, and “The Jagorb” caught their interest when they saw it in LA Splash Magazine.”

Ricky Gervais tapped as host of Golden GlobesLOS ANGELES  British comedian Ricky Gervais has been picked as host of the Golden Globes, the first time in more than a decade that the Hollywood awards show has used an emcee. A more freewheeling affair than the Academy Awards and other Hollywood honors, the Globes are known as a place where stars can cut loose over dinner and drinks. Gervais said it was a good environment to give him free rein as host.

“I have resisted many other offers like this, but there are just some things you don’t turn down,” said Gervais, who starred in HBO’s “Extras” and the original British version of “The Office.” The Globes have gone without a host since 1995, when John Larroquette and Janine Turner teamed up for the job. Globe organizers decided to do away with the host because they felt the show had enough star power with the celebrities presenting its film and TV awards.

Ricky Gervais is known as an edgy comedian, and the Golden Globes are considered the least stuffy of film and television awards shows. So it's little wonder that Gervais sees his hosting job for the 2010 ceremony as a match made in Hollywood honors heaven. "Everyone is sitting around and drinking. I'm going to be drunk, and I'm not going to rehearse. So, it's the perfect gig for me," Gervais told Reuters on Tuesday, with a laugh.

The Golden Globe Awards, which will be given out on January 17, 2010, are one of Hollywood's biggest awards show, but the atmosphere is less formal than the film industry's Oscars or TV's Emmys. Winners in both film and TV categories, who are picked by members of the Hollywood Foreign Press Association, are named after a fine dinner where cocktails and champagne flow freely, and the ceremony is often dubbed Hollywood's biggest party.

Ricky Gervais to host Golden GlobesSIX years after Ricky Gervais caused an upset at The Golden Globes – when The Office beat better known programs such as Arrested Development and Sex and the City for the best comedy trophy and Gervais was named best comedy actor – the British comedian will return to host the awards on January 17, according to Variety. It will be the first time since 1995 that the show has had a host. The organisers hired Gervais because of his appearance as a presenter last year when he teased The Reader star Kate Winslet about finally winning her first statuette from the Hollywood Foreign Press Association. "I told you. Do a Holocaust movie and the awards come. Didn't I?"

Gervais said he had resisted similar offers but the Globes offered him a chance for "free rein as a host." In an interview with The New York Times in March the comedian cited his reluctance to do award shows, specifically the Academy Awards, describing it as a "thankless task for a comedian". Either way, his hiring will be an improvement on last year's show, at which, because of the writers' strike, a list of winners was merely read out.

Laura Dern Becoming a Focker in 'Meet the Parents' SequelThe Focker family of 'Meet the Parents' fame just keeps expanding its dysfunctional circle: Now, they've ensnared Oscar nominee and Golden Globe winner Laura Dern.

According to the Hollywood Reporter, Universal Pictures and Tribeca Productions has signed the actress to appear in the series' third installment, tentatively titled 'Little Fockers.' 'American Pie' director Paul Weitz will attempt to control the cast, which brings back "Focker" regulars Ben Stiller, Robert De Niro, Teri Polo, Blythe Danner and Owen Wilson, plus newcomer Jessica Alba for a summer 2010 release.

Dern, who was nominated for an Academy Award for 1991's 'Rambling Rose' and won a Golden Globe for 'Recount,' is slated to play the headmistress of the Focker kids' elementary school. We're betting the school curriculum includes home security surveillance, fire safety and pet disposal.

Actress Jane Seymour puts her whole heart into her artThe Golden Globe and Emmy Award-winning actress will be at The Woodlands Mall this weekend to promote her watercolors, oil paintings, bronze sculptures and accessories, and she'll also autograph her latest book, Open Hearts.

Not to worry. Folks who would rather talk to her about her fabulous acting career, or movie stars she has known and admired, will have the chance to do that, too.

The Chronicle caught up with Seymour, 58, just before her visit here.

Q: How did you get your start?

A: I wanted to be a dancer, but when I was young I was kicked out of class because I had flat feet and a speech impediment. I couldn't pronounce my r's.

So I was put in a special remedial dance class and in voice training.

Later on in my career, I specialized in languages, and I was always doing accents. The funny part is, the two things I was not so good at turned out to be blessings. That's the story of my life.
